Default Subtotals order

I have a client column and a result column. I am trying to summarize by
counting how many samples I have in a cascading fashion, so I want to know
first how many per client, then per client how many of each result. I tried
doing a subtotal count at each change in result, then a second subtotal count
at each change in client. But Excel kept cutting off the result in the last
few clients. Any thoughts?

The worksheet looks like this:
Client Result
0000 No virus
0000 No virus
0000 Flu A
0001 No Virus
0001 No Virus
0001 RSV A

All I want is a subtotal of each result per client.
i.e.
Client
0000 2 No Virus
1 Flu A
0001 2 No Virus
1 RSV A
